| Zusammenfassung: | "Practicing Oral History to Connect University to Community illustrates best practices for using oral histories to foster a closer relationship between universities and their surrounding communities. It is an important resource both for oral historians and those working to improve relationships between universities and their communities"-- Building relationships between the university and the community -- Community outreach -- Funding an oral history project -- The process of oral history: planning -- The process of oral history: the interview -- Ethics and best practices for oral history -- Telling the world: sharing the project and making it accessible to the community -- Oral history in the classroom -- Preservation -- Community collaborations |
